From the Guidelines
Calcium supplements can decrease phosphate levels by forming insoluble complexes in the intestinal tract, which reduces phosphate absorption.
Key Points
- Phosphate supplements should not be given together with calcium supplements or foods with high calcium content, such as milk, as precipitation in the intestinal tract reduces absorption 1.
- Calcium supplements are not recommended for patients with X-linked hypophosphataemia due to the potential risk of hypercalciuria and decreased phosphate absorption 1.
- Nutritional calcium intake should be kept within the normal range for age to avoid excessive calcium absorption and potential adverse effects on phosphate levels 1.
- Phosphate supplements should be given as frequently as possible, for example, 4–6 times per day in young patients with high ALP levels, to maintain stable blood levels 1.
- Active vitamin D (calcitriol or alfacalcidol) is given in addition to oral phosphate supplements to counter calcitriol deficiency, prevent secondary hyperparathyroidism, and increase phosphate absorption from the gut 1.

Effect of Calcium Supplements on Phosphate Levels
The relationship between calcium supplements and phosphate levels in the prevention of osteoporosis is complex. Key points to consider include:
- Calcium supplements can affect phosphate levels, as bone mineral consists of calcium phosphate, and phosphorus is essential for bone health 2
- High-dose calcium supplements can bind to food phosphorus, making it unavailable for absorption, which may lead to negative phosphorus balances 2
- A calcium phosphate supplement may be preferable to other forms of calcium supplements, as it can spare food phosphorus and support bone health 2
Risks and Benefits of Calcium Supplementation
While calcium supplements are often used to prevent osteoporosis, their effectiveness and safety are debated. Consider the following:
- Some studies suggest that calcium supplements may have a negative risk-benefit effect, with increased risks of gastrointestinal side effects, renal calculi, and myocardial infarction 3
- Calcium supplementation may not be effective in preventing fractures, with some studies showing little evidence of a relationship between calcium intake and bone density or fracture risk 3, 4
- The optimal intake of calcium and its role in osteoporosis prevention are still unclear, and further studies are needed to determine the health effects of calcium supplementation 5, 6
